June Curran Porcaro Scholarship

Accepting Applications

About the Scholarship

Opens: 6/1/2024
Closes: 7/16/2024

June Curran Porcaro Scholarship provides financial assistance to members of the Sault Tribe of Chippewa Indians who have been homeless, displaced, or in the foster care system and are interested in attending college or graduate school in any state to work on a degree in human services.

Win up to
$1,000
  • Essay Required: Yes
  • Need-Based: Yes
  • Merit-Based: No
Requirements
  • This program is open to members of the Sault Tribe who have been homeless, displaced, or in the foster care system.
  • Applicants must be working on an undergraduate or graduate degree in human services at a college or university in any state to prepare for a career of helping people who are homeless, displaced, or involved in the foster care system.
  • They must be able to demonstrate financial need.
  • Recipients must agree to provide at least 40 hours of volunteer service at an accredited homeless shelter during the school year for which they receive the award.
